Insights From The Experts

Tip 1:

Schedule regular wind mitigation inspections, especially before hurricane season hits. Doing so not only secures your peace of mind but also ensures any vulnerabilities are addressed promptly to protect your property in Florida.

Tip 2:

When getting a roof inspection, ask your inspector to check for specific signs of wear and tear common in Florida’s climate, such as UV damage, moisture intrusion, and wind lift.

Tip 3:

Invest in impact-resistant roofing materials if you’re building new or replacing your roof. These can significantly bolster your home’s defenses against Florida’s frequent high winds and flying debris.

Tip 4:

Don’t overlook the attic during inspections. Proper ventilation and insulation can play a crucial role in wind mitigation by reducing the chances of uplift during a severe storm.

Tip 5:

Stay informed about local building codes and roofing standards. They are often updated to improve safety and wind mitigation; ensuring your roof is up to code can also affect insurance premiums in Florida.

Addressing Common Concerns

What Exactly Is Wind Mitigation And Why Is It Important In Florida?

Wind mitigation involves implementing certain features on a roof to resist or lessen the impact of high winds caused by storms or hurricanes, which is essential in a hurricane-prone state like Florida to protect properties and potentially reduce insurance costs.

How Often Should A Roof Inspection Take Place?

In Florida, it’s recommended to have a roof inspection at least once a year or after any major storm event to ensure any damage is identified and addressed promptly, preserving the integrity of the roof.

Can A Wind Mitigation And Roof Inspection Really Lower My Insurance Premiums?

Yes, in Florida, wind mitigation inspections can lead to insurance discounts as they prove your home is better equipped to withstand storm damage, reducing the risk and potential cost for insurers.

What Are The Signs Of Potential Roof Damage I Should Be Aware Of?

Be vigilant for missing or damaged shingles, leaks in your attic after heavy rainfall, granules from shingles accumulating in gutters, or any visible sagging, as these can be indicators of potential roof damage.

What Measures Are Included In The Wind Mitigation Process To Protect My Home?

Wind mitigation measures can include adding roof-to-wall attachments, reinforcing roof decking, installing a secondary water barrier, and ensuring proper attic bracing, all tailored to enhance a structure’s ability to withstand strong winds.
